Tip 12 Ask Family and Friends to be There for You

Ask your family and friends to be there for you when you need them. Be prepared to wake someone during the night when you feel that you need to talk. Dont handle things on your own when you can reach out to those people who love you and want.

Develop your own mission statement. Businesses come up with a mission statement that defines their goals and purpose. Its important that you do the same thing. If you had to sum up your life purpose in a single sentence, what would it be? Take some time to define your own personal mission so that you are as clear as possible about where you are going and how you are going to get there.
